The antiendomysial antibody test is a histological assay for patient serum binding to esophageal tissue from primate. EmA are present in celiac disease . They do not cause any direct symptoms to muscles, but detection of EmA is useful in the diagnosis of the disease.

Enteropathy-associated T-cell lymphoma (EATL), previously termed enteropathy-associated T-cell lymphoma, type I and at one time termed enteropathy-type T-cell lymphoma (ETTL), is a complication of coeliac disease in which a malignant T-cell lymphoma develops in areas of the small intestine affected by the disease's intense inflammation.
